Output 3d63da6eeeb945856527dfa57be63cfb57a19002dd8edd046b0090bfe2799e5f:7

value
12623452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f9ba352d8fb4e70f0a9881106ff1aff3931e72c OP_EQUALVERIFY OP_CHECKSIG
address
19iXe99ifknW6EaZ6qDe8pbaNP62KdxsCZ
transaction
3d63da6eeeb945856527dfa57be63cfb57a19002dd8edd046b0090bfe2799e5f
spent
true